Transaction 840a76e4e24fbd9fe476f725aeaa2959f42b4d90b5b8f51f47866d14199d100d

1 Input
2 Outputs
  • 840a76e4e24fbd9fe476f725aeaa2959f42b4d90b5b8f51f47866d14199d100d:0
  • value  876651
    address  3N4TUk4da9aKbXAwuu9dAV57edew4ZU3gE
  • 840a76e4e24fbd9fe476f725aeaa2959f42b4d90b5b8f51f47866d14199d100d:1
  • value  341204453
    address  3QzvrUx2E2acc3VjM3wa4eDAmwPLpBcZen